#!/usr/bin/python
# coding:utf-8
import sys
import time
import os
urls = ['http://one.com/1', 'http://one.com/2', 'http://one.com/3']
while 1:
date_time = time.strftime('%Y-%m-%d %H:%M:%S', time.localtime(time.time()))
sys.stdout.write('%s\n' % date_time)
for url in urls:
sys.stdout.write('%s\n' % url)
time.sleep(2)
os.system('clear')
像这种输出之后把已经输出的清空,再输出下一次还有别的方法么?试了下'\r',但是没达到预期效果,其中 urls 是一个变量,定时更新。
谢谢